What is one benefit of a clear contract?

Explanation:
A clear contract serves as a foundational document that explicitly outlines the expectations, responsibilities, and rights of all parties involved. This clarity minimizes ambiguity, ensuring that everyone understands their obligations and the terms of the agreement. By defining terms clearly, a well-drafted contract acts as a protective measure, safeguarding the interests of each party and providing a reference point in case of disputes. This can help streamline communication and reduce the likelihood of conflicts arising from misunderstandings.
